Google Media Server launched
Search engine giant Google has launched a new application named Google Media Server.
It is currently available on the Windows platform. It uses company’s other technologies to locate media files on a user’s machine and makes them available on an UPnP-enabled device like the Sony Playstation 3.
The application is currently capable of:
Access videos, music, and photos stored on your PC
View Picasa Web Albums
Play your favorite YouTube videos
